About the role

  • Providing effective project governance to ensure implementations are delivered on time, within budget, and aligned with agreed requirements.
  • Translating Statements of Work, customer requirements, and product capabilities into comprehensive implementation roadmaps, including tasks, milestones, deliverables, and risk mitigation strategies.
  • Partnering with Project Managers to analyze and support the development of detailed project artifacts and delivery plans.
  • Serving as the primary point of contact for project stakeholders, delivering transparent status updates and managing expectations across all levels.
  • Coordinating cross‑functional teams including Product, Market Planning, Sales, Account Management, Project Management, and Professional Services, as well as corresponding client‑side teams.
  • Ensuring project teams identify risks and gaps in customer requirements and execute solution configuration aligned to client workflows and internal software guidelines.
  • Applying technical understanding of system architecture, integrations, APIs, data inputs, workflows, and configuration options to support successful implementations.
  • Leading issue resolution efforts, addressing technical blockers, and guiding teams toward creative, effective solutions.
  • Overseeing customer‑reported issues during User Acceptance Testing (UAT) and post‑go‑live hypercare to ensure solutions function as intended and agreed.
  • Promoting strong communication, active listening, and stakeholder trust throughout the implementation lifecycle.

Requirements

  • Typically 10+ years of experience in program management or software implementation roles
  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Computer Science, or Information Technology
  • Preferred certifications include CIS, CBPA, CRCM, CAMS, PMP, or Agile/Scrum
  • Understanding of software implementation practices, including on‑premise and cloud architectures, system integrations, APIs, and data input processes
  • Preferred familiarity with name screening software and Screening Compliance Program requirements
  • Expert use of tools such as PowerPoint, JIRA, AdaptiveWork, and Salesforce
  • Strong ability to translate technical concepts for non‑technical stakeholders.
